Port Overview

Belem, Brazil, docks on the Amazon River, 2 kilometers from downtown, with taxis for 10-minute rides. The city, population 1.5 million, features the Ver-o-Peso Market with açaí stalls. Travelers visit the Theatro da Paz, an 1878 opera house. Excursions to Ilha do Marajó, 2 hours by ferry, spot water buffalo. Peak season July to December; taxis 10-20 BRL. Dining includes tacacá soup at riverside stalls. Souvenirs feature Amazonian seeds.

Cruise Port Location

Belem, Brazil cruise port is located in the northern part of the country, on the banks of the Para River, near the mouth of the Amazon River. It is the capital of the state of Para and is known for its colonial architecture, vibrant culture, and natural beauty. The port is easily accessible by air, land, and sea, and is a popular destination for cruise ships.

Exploring the Museums and Historic Sites

Exploring the museums and historic sites of Belem is another popular activity for cruise passengers. Belem is home to a number of museums, including the Museu Paraense Emilio Goeldi, which is dedicated to the natural history of the Amazon region. Cruise passengers can also visit the historic sites of Belem, such as the Forte do Presépio, which was built in the 17th century to protect the city from pirates. Exploring the museums and historic sites of Belem is a great way to learn about the city's rich history and culture.

Visiting the Ver-o-Peso Market

The Ver-o-Peso Market is one of the most popular attractions for cruise passengers visiting Belem, Brazil. The market is located in the historic center of Belem, and it is the largest open-air market in Latin America. Cruise passengers can explore the market and find a variety of local goods, including fresh produce, handmade crafts, and traditional clothing. The market is also a great place to sample local cuisine and experience the vibrant culture of Belem.

The Ver-o-Peso Market

The Ver-o-Peso Market is a bustling marketplace located in the heart of Belem. It is the oldest market in the city, having been established in 1688. It is a great place to find local produce, seafood, and handicrafts, as well as to experience the vibrant culture of the city. It is also a popular tourist destination, with many visitors coming to explore the market and its unique offerings.

Belem Cruise Terminals

Porto de Belem

Porto de Belem is the main cruise ship terminal in Belem, Brazil. It is located on the banks of the Para River and is the largest port in the Amazon region. It is a modern port with a wide range of services and facilities, including a passenger terminal, cargo handling, and a variety of restaurants and shops.

Can I rent a car at Belem cruise port?

Near the Belem, Brazil cruise port, there are several car rental options available. These include local car rental companies such as Localiza, Unidas, and Movida, as well as international companies such as Hertz, Avis, and Europcar. All of these companies offer a variety of vehicles, from economy cars to luxury vehicles, and all offer competitive rates. Additionally, many of these companies offer special discounts and packages for cruise passengers.
